Geek Wedding Ceremony.

Recently I performed a wedding ceremony for my friend Randy Noseworthy and his bride Janet Noseworthy.  What follows is the service as written and pretty much performed.

$Celebrant:

We are gathered here today in the face of this gathering of geeks, to merge these two projects ($Groom_Name) and ($Bride_Name) in to a single trunk: which is an honorable and solemn project and therefore is not be be entered into unadvisedly or light but reverently and soberly. Into this trunk these two projects come now to be joined. If any one can show just cause why then man not be merged successfully, them them speak now or forever revoke there commit privileges.

Optional Section (giving away the bride)

Who grants commit acces for this Woman to This

Man

($person_giving_commit_acces)

I Do.

$Celebrant to $Groom_Name:

($Groom_Name), do you consent to give ($Bride_Name) merge access to current, to live in a state of unity. Will you love, honor, comfort and cherish her from this day forward forsaking all other projects keeping only unto her for as long as you both shall process?

$Groom_Name:

I Do

$Celebrant to $Bride_Name:

($Groom_Name), do you consent to give ($Bride_Name) merge access to current, to live in a state of unity. Will you love, honor, comfort and cherish her from this day forward forsaking all other projects keeping only unto her for as long as you both shall process?

$Bride_Name:

I do

$Celebrant: addressing the $Groom_Name who repeats the marriage vows:

I ($Groom_Name) give thee ($Bride_Name) commit access to my life to merge our paths into a single source tree as my wife for better for worse for richer for poorer in sickness and in health to love honor and cherish till netsplit do us part

$Celebrant: addressing the $Groom_Name who repeats the marriage vows:

I ($Bride_Name) give thee ($Groom_Name) commit access to my life to merge our paths into a single source tree as my wife for better for worse for richer for poorer in sickness and in health to love honor and cherish till netsplit do us part

$Celebrant then asks for the brides ring from the best man.

$Celebrant: (about brides ring):

May this ring be a token of the love and commit access that the user intends to bestow upon the recipient.

$Groom_Name: placing ring on $Bride_Name’s finger:

With this ring I thee wed. Wear it as a symbol of our love and commitment.

$Celebrant: (about $Groom_Name’s ring):

May this ring be a token of the love and commit access that the user intends to bestow upon the recipient.

$Groom_Name: placing ring on $Bride_Name’s finger:

With this ring I thee wed. Wear it as a symbol of our love and commitment.

$Celebrant:

At this Time ($Groom_Name) and ($Bride_Name) will begin the compile of the Linux kernel from source. This event symbolizes that marriage is the culmination of a collaborative process. Even though there may be errors along the way that threw a process of conflict resolution and communication that it can be fixed and made better over time.

$Celebrant:

May this couple be prepared to continue to give, be able to resolve conflicts, and experience more and more joy with each passing day, and every passing year. ($Groom_Name) and ($Bride_Name), are now beginning the process of merging their life’s, we hope that they may have loving assistance from their family, the constant support of friends and fellow penguin people and a long life with good health and everlasting love. In so much as ($Groom_Name) and ($Bride_Name) have consented to merge together in wedlock, and have witnessed the same before this company, having given commit access to the other and having declared same by the giving and receiving of a ring, I pronounce that they are husband and wife.

$Celebrant: (to the couple):

You may now Kiss the $Bride.

$Celebrant:

Ladies and gentlemen, I present to you

Mr. and Mrs.…………
